White House blasts Spanish government as thousands of migrants surge from Morocco, emergency request denied

The White House bashed Spain’s left-wing government after the border between Spain’s North African enclave of Ceuta and Morocco collapsed Thursday. 

“President Trump has long warned Europe what would happen if they continue to implement far-left, globalist policies – including enabling mass migration. Spain and other countries who have adopted this destructive philosophy should immediately reverse course or risk their own demise,” White House principal deputy press secretary Anna Kelly told Fox News in a statement.

Ceuta’s president formally requested a national emergency declaration Thursday after more than 2,000 migrants crossed the border from Morocco in the past 10 days, as videos showed chaotic scenes of migrants pouring into the Spanish territory.

Video shows hordes of apparently military-aged men smiling and posing for cameras, some carrying swimming flippers, and sprinting through the streets as authorities struggle to corral the unruly masses.

Other footage shows crowds of migrants emerging from the sea, climbing up onto Ceuta’s rocky shores and working their way around border fences.

Ceuta President Juan Jesús Vivas formally requested that Spanish Prime Minister Pedro Sánchez declare a national emergency to help respond to the border crisis, Spanish media outlets reported. Madrid, however, denied the request.

“The declaration of a national emergency is part of the state civil protection regulations, which do not consider migratory flows as a risk to the National Civil Protection System, nor do they establish special plans, basic guidelines, or specific civil protection instruments for their management. Therefore, it is not possible to activate this mechanism, as requested by the president of the Government of Ceuta, Juan Jesús Vivas,” Spain’s Ministry of the Interior said in a statement, according to Spanish outlet El Pais.

Ceuta’s government, in their request for a national emergency declaration, noted that immigration from Moroco is always a problem for the Spanish enclave, but claimed the last 10 days represented a peak “of particular intensity.” That peak has seen more than 2,000 migrants cross the border in the past 10 days, Ceuta officials said, according to El Pais.

Spanish and Moroccan maritime patrols, supported by Spain's Maritime Rescue service, conduct rescue operations off the southern coast of Ceuta after a sharp increase in migrant arrivals to the Spanish enclave in North Africa. Nearly 2,000 migrants have reached Ceuta over the past two weeks, most by swimming around the Tarajal breakwater separating Spain from Morocco. The arrivals include hundreds of unaccompanied minors, prompting local authorities to warn that child protection facilities have been overwhelmed as rescue and border surveillance operations continue.

“The Government of Spain is fully committed to providing an immediate response to the situation in Ceuta. We are mobilizing all necessary resources, working with Moroccan and international authorities, and preparing the necessary measures to restore normalcy as soon as possible,” Sánchez wrote in a Thursday post on X.

Sánchez has faced considerable backlash from his country’s conservatives for his policies on immigration, with many arguing that Spain’s policy of guaranteeing social services to minors who illegally enter the country incentivizes mass migration.

“When they cross the border as minors, you cannot send them back to Morocco,” Javier Negre, a conservative Spanish journalist and owner of La Derecha Diario and UHN Plus, told Fox News Digital.

“The Spanish state has to take care of them and pay money to NGOs to care for these minors until they turn 18,” he continued.

“It’s proof that Europe and Spain are on the verge of becoming a failed continent because of the future policies and promotion of this illegal invasion under Pedro Sánchez,” Negre criticized.

Sánchez, for his part, has claimed that accepting migrants is necessary to keep Spain’s economy alive, arguing the country’s low birth rates necessitate accepting immigrants.

“The West needs people. Currently, few of its countries have a rising population growth rate. Unless they embrace migration, they will experience a sharp demographic decline that will prevent them from keeping their economies and public services afloat. Their gross domestic product will stagnate. Their public healthcare and pension systems will suffer. Neither AI nor robots will be able to prevent this outcome… The only option to avoid decline is to integrate migrants in the most orderly and effective way possible,” Sánchez wrote in a February op-ed in The New York Times.
